Stony Point, NY - After a decade of service to the residents of Stony Point, Supervisor Jim Monaghan has announced that he will not seek re-election, bringing his tenure to a close at the end of this year. In a brief phone interview with Rockland News, Monaghan reflected on his time in office, expressing appreciation for the opportunity to serve the community. Stony Point Seals Take the Plunge Again – Despite Snow and Cold
Stony Point, NY – Undeterred by five inches of overnight snowfall, members of Rockland’s boldest charity once again took to the icy waters of the Hudson River, to raise money for local kids. The Stony Point Seals gathered at the Stony Point Seawall on February 9, 2025, for their 26th annual Polar Plunge.
